Establish a Classification System for Streamlined Junk Removal
An effective sorting system is crucial for streamlining the junk removal process. By organizing items, individuals can more easily figure out what to retain, donate, recycle, or discard. The first step involves assembling containers or bags labeled for each category. This visual aid aids in maintaining focus during the sorting activity.
Next, one should carefully tackle each section, putting items into their respective containers as they go. It is advisable to be candid about the need of each item, asking whether it offers value or joy. Keeping a timer can also boost productivity, encouraging prompt decisions and limiting second-guessing.
After sorting is done, the next step is to transfer items from the designated containers to their final destinations. This methodical approach not only simplifies the junk removal process but also cultivates a sense of accomplishment, ultimately creating a more organized and serene living space.

Collect Your Important Decluttering Tools
When embarking on a decluttering journey, having the right tools at hand can substantially streamline the process. Important tools include sturdy boxes or bins for sorting items into categories such as keep, donate, and discard. Labeling materials, including markers and adhesive labels, help make certain that each box is easily identifiable, streamlining the decision-making process. A tape measure can also be useful for determining if indeed larger items fit into designated spaces.
In addition, garbage bags are vital for quickly disposing of discarded items. For items that require special handling, such as electronics or hazardous materials, it's vital to have a plan and appropriate containers. Last but not least, a notebook or digital app can aid in tracking progress and jotting down ideas regarding future organization. By preparing yourself with these key decluttering tools, the journey toward a tidier and clutter-free space becomes noticeably more manageable.
Tips for Lasting Organization After Simplifying
Creating lasting structure after decluttering demands steady habits and strategic planning. To maintain an organized space, individuals should establish a routine for consistent tidying. This can include allocating a particular time each week to review belongings and return items to their designated places.
Using storage solutions, such as bins or shelves, can also assist in keep items sorted and easily accessible. Labeling these storage containers ensures clarity, making it simpler to identify necessary items without rummaging through clutter.
In addition, implementing a one-in-one-out policy can avoid future accumulation. This implies that for every new item brought into the home, an old item should be eliminated.
Lastly, periodically reassessing your space and belongings can aid in recognize any new clutter and resolve it quickly, promoting a long-term organizational system. By following these strategies, individuals can maintain a clutter-free environment for the long term.

Hazardous Materials Handling
Handling hazardous materials requires careful consideration and expertise, as incorrect disposal can create substantial health and safety risks. Items including batteries, paints, chemicals, and electronic waste contain substances that can harm the environment and human health if not managed correctly. It is vital for individuals to recognize when these materials are present and to be aware of the legal regulations governing their disposal. In cases involving hazardous waste, employing professional junk removal services is advisable. These experts are trained to safely manage and dispose of hazardous materials while adhering to local laws. By hiring professionals, individuals can ensure their space is decluttered without compromising safety or the environment.

How Do I Properly Recycle Electronic Waste?
To recycle electronic waste properly, it's important to locate certified e-waste recycling centers, follow local regulations, and guarantee devices are wiped clean of personal data ahead of disposal. This encourages environmental sustainability and reduces damaging landfill impact.

Can Damaged or Broken Items Be Donated?
Giving away defective or non-functional items is typically not encouraged, as the majority of organizations favor functional goods. Nevertheless, some charitable organizations may take them for repair or recycling. It's advisable to check directly with the individual organization before contributing.
